United Kingdom
Lobster claw plant is it hardy in the uk
On plant
Heliconia rostrata
7 Sep, 2010
Previous question
« my neighbor found a spider in his garden yesterday and i have no idea wat kind it...
Next question
No, will not tolerate temperatures under 5 degC
8 Sep, 2010